Hello, I like what you have done here, and it looks like it is like woven and stitched in some way.

Although I would really recommend that you do two very easy things (without having to entering into Filter Editor)

1 - LIGHTING - Please, go to to the Lighting tab and rise the brightness for each of the presets as they look too dark and does not really shown the power of the filter, and you really can´t see what is there. I see that all the presets needs to add more Lighting.

For example, in preset 5 when going to the Lighting Tab, the default value for Brightness is 22, and if you rise it to 190, you make it really shine and you can see it much better. I would put around 190 value in all of them.

2 - SEAMLESS TILING - Although this is something optional, and not bad, I would not recommend to put active by default the seamless tiling on every single preset, because seamless does not work with non-square images or probably better said, the seamless tiling must have an integer aspect ratio to work, so if you load any other image that is not this way, you will get a FF message telling you that you can´t use it.
